Preparing search index...

    Function buildFetchQueue

    • Builds the list of URLs to fetch, prioritizing visible items over buffer items.

      Parameters

      • visibleRecipes: DiscoveredRecipe[]

        Visible recipes needing images

      • bufferRecipes: DiscoveredRecipe[]

        Buffer zone recipes needing images

      • fetchedUrls: Set<string>

        Set of already fetched recipe URLs

      • pendingUrls: Set<string>

        Set of currently pending recipe URLs

      Returns string[]

      Array of URLs to fetch in priority order